#Rwanda - Victoire Ingabire Umuhoza is a prominent political opposition figure & activist who has long been persecuted in Rwanda. In June, she was re-arrested on baseless charges as part of the government’s broader effort to silence opposition voices www.freedom-now.org/cases/victoi...

#Cameroon - Thomas Awah Jr. is a journalist & activist who is serving an 11-year prison sentence for reporting on protests in the Anglophone region. We filed a petition with the UNWGAD, which found his detention violates international law. www.freedom-now.org/cases/thomas...

#Togo - Abdoul Aziz Goma is an Irish national of Togolese origin serving a 10-year prison sentence on fabricated charges of criminal conspiracy & disturbing public order for providing humanitarian support to local protestors. www.freedom-now.org/cases/abdoul...

It has been 10 years since #Tajikistan arrested human rights lawyer Buzurgmehr Yorov. He remains imprisoned on politically motivated charges. Freedom Now and 11 human rights organizations renew our call for his immediate and unconditional release www.freedom-now.org/tajikistan-l...
